Not Your Majesty, but Your Emergency. the Mayor of Lviv Missed the Mark when Welcoming the King of Sweden

Summary by Novinky.cz
The mayor of Lviv, western Ukraine, Andriy Sadovoy, made a funny faux pas when he welcomed the Swedish King Carl XVI Gustaf in the square in front of the city hall. He wanted to address him as "Your Majesty", but instead he accidentally said "Your Emergency", which literally translates to "Your emergency" and doesn't make much sense as a form of address.
